CVE-2026-1770

MEDIUMCVSS 4.5/10EPSS 0.43%

Last modified

CVE-2026-1770 is a medium-severity vulnerability rated 4.5/10 on the CVSS scale. Improper Control of Dynamically-Managed Code Resources vulnerability in Crafter Studio of Crafter CMS allows authenticated developers to execute OS commands via Groovy Sandbox Bypass. By inserting malicious Groovy elements, an attacker may bypass sandbox restrictions and obtain RCE (Remote Code Execution).. EPSS estimates a 0.43% chance of exploitation in the next 30 days.
